Course Description

Hi, my name is Lauren Hansen and I am a 3rd year occupational therapy student at Drake University in Des Moines, IA. This course reviews my doctoral capstone, which focused on aging in place and home accessibility. I completed my capstone at the Greater Des Moines Habitat for Humanity, working with their Home Preservation and Aging at Home Program. My capstone was 14 weeks long and during that time I was exposed to the process of home modifications and aging in place. This course will cover my needs assessment and review of literature which looks at the importance and need for aging in place and home accessibility. It will discuss the role occupational therapist can play in planning to age at home. The course will also talk about Habitat for Humanity and describe in detail the Aging at Home Program that is offered. Lastly, my course will review my completed capstone projects, which includes a guide to home modifications, an accessible home layout, a discussion on home modifications for sensory processing disorders, and discuss my completion of the Aging in Place Specialists Certification (CAPS). Planning to age in place and having an accessible home is important for individuals of all ages and abilities!
